PLASTICS - DETERMINATION OF THERMAL CONDUCTIVITY AND THERMAL DIFFUSIVITY - PART 2: TRANSIENT PLANE HEAT SOURCE (HOT DISC) METHOD (ISO/DIS 22007-2:2013)

Defines a method for the determination of the thermal conductivity and thermal diffusivity, and hence the specific heat capacity per unit volume, of plastics.
